We are a team of enthusiastic individuals who are dedicated to meeting and exceeding the needs of the customers we serve.Job DescriptionSalary Range – $As a Strategic Development Program Trainee, you will progress through a 5 phased program to learn every aspect of our business from shipping and receiving, to sales, operations, purchasing, account management and everything in between.Additional duties will include:Phase 1 -Warehouse Logistics

  • Learn the products we sell, how they get from the vendor to the customer and understand all levels of sales support.

Phase 2 – Operations

  • Get involved in our customer service, counter sales, order management, inventory and pricing controls, credit management, financial statements, and much more…

Phase 3 – Inside Sales/Project Management

  • Go from helping customers with various product and service issues to managing large-scale projects.

Phase 4 – Outside Sales/Account Management

  • Learn how to find new business opportunities, sell our products, negotiate contracts, and build customer and vendor relationships.

Phase 5 – In this phase, you can take all of your training and determine your ideal career path.Qualifications
